次の方法で共有


CKeyboardManager::LoadState

更新 : 2007 年 11 月

Windows レジストリからショートカット キーのテーブルを読み込みます。

BOOL LoadState(
   LPCTSTR lpszProfileName = NULL,
   CFrameWnd* pDefaultFrame = NULL
);

パラメータ

  • [入力] lpszProfileName
    CKeyboardManager データの保存場所を示すレジストリ パス。

  • [入力] pDefaultFrame
    既定のウィンドウとして使用するフレーム ウィンドウへのポインタ。

戻り値

状態が正常に読み込まれた場合は 0 以外の値。それ以外の場合は 0。

解説

lpszProfileName パラメータが NULL の場合、このメソッドは、既定のレジストリの場所で CKeyboardManager データを探します。既定のレジストリの場所は、CWinAppEx クラス により指定されます。データは、CKeyboardManager::SaveState メソッドを使用して事前に書き込む必要があります。

既定のウィンドウを指定しないと、アプリケーションのメイン フレーム ウィンドウが使用されます。

必要条件

ヘッダー : afxkeyboardmanager.h

参照

概念

MFC 階層図

参照

CKeyboardManager クラス

CWinAppEx クラス

CKeyboardManager::SaveState